Fargo Force forward Axel Lofgren, one of the top Swedish prospects and overall players in the USHL, has earned an invitation to the 2026 Colorado Avalanche Development Camp, marking another major milestone in his hockey development journey.
The Colorado Avalanche Development Camp invitation is well-deserved recognition for Lofgren, who has established himself as one of the most impactful players in the United States Hockey League (USHL). As one of the premier Swedish players competing in North American junior hockey, Axel has consistently showcased the skill, hockey IQ, pace, and competitive drive that have made him a highly regarded prospect among NCAA and professional evaluators.
Competing with the Fargo Force, Lofgren has emerged as one of the league’s standout talents, proving himself against some of the top junior players in the world. His ability to create offense, play with speed, and impact games in all situations has helped elevate his profile as both a top international prospect and one of the best overall players in the USHL.
Lofgren is committed to the University of Minnesota, where he will continue his NCAA hockey career with one of college hockey’s most storied and successful programs.
